On Mon, Nov 15, 2021 at 09:36:55AM -0600, Mario Limonciello wrote:
> commit 91adec9e0709 ("drm/amd/display: Look at firmware version to
> determine using dmub on dcn21")
>
> Newer DMUB firmware on Renoir and Green Sardine do not need to disable
> dmcu and this actually causes problems with DP-C alt mode for a number of
> machines.
>
> Backport the fix from this from hand modified backport because mainline
> switched to IP version checking which doesn't exist in linux-stable.
